Under the Mistletoe- Timeless Romance Anthology


From the publisher of the USA TODAY bestselling Timeless Romance Anthology Series. Six contemporary novellas, all adding sweet romance to the Christmas season.

Forgotten Kisses by Cindy Roland Anderson
The Last Christmas by Annette Lyon
Truth or Dare by Julie Coulter Bellon
Holiday Bucket List by Sarah M. Eden
Christmas Every Day by Heather B. Moore
First and Last Christmas Date by Jennifer Griffith

Review:

This was an engaging, relatable and heartwarming Christmas book. I enjoyed each of the novella's. They were all very different but full of love and the magic of the holiday season. The stories were well written and enjoyed the storylines.

Forgotten Kisses is about a costume designer who's ex-boyfriend gets cast in the show she is working on. It's a great second chances book centered on always being honest with each other. I loved this novella! I'm always impressed with Cindy's books and want to read more. 5

The Last Christmas is about a couple on the verge of divorce and hiding it until Christmas is over. I enjoyed this book and the main lessoned learned is communication is key and especially in a marriage. I enjoyed how it was written and I'm glad they took a second chance on love. 4.5

Truth or Dare is a novella about life's challenges and that if you let people into your lives they can help you have hope and happiness. Jonah is a war veteran that lost his leg and is struggling and when a blizzard hit he was stranded with his long time friend Cami. He hasn't seen Cami for a long time and he wasn't the nicest at first but as they spent time together and opened up magic happened. I enjoyed this book and how they were able to help each other. 4.5

Holiday Bucket List is about two long time neighbor friends and the memories they make at Christmas time. It is Celeste's first time being alone for Christmas and Mike helps her not feel lonely by creating silly bucket lists for them to achieve. Their friendship is very strong but at this special time of year they realize how much they would love more than just friendship. After seven years the sparks fly and it could be the end of their being alone. 4.5

Christmas Everyday is a sweet Christmas novella full of forgiveness, hope and the magic of the Christmas season. Monica is excited to buy the Christmas store where she works but her boyfriend is not happy about it. Eww I am not a fan of Monica's boyfriend... what a jerk! Jaxon comes to town to repair his relationship with his parents and before he makes it home helps a girl from her rude boyfriend. I loved his caring nature and his willingness to help and give Monica hope. This was a sweet story and I enjoyed the relationship they begin to develop. 5

First and Last Christmas Date is a funny Christmas novella about two friends who went on a terrible first date and then didn't go out again for ten years! And once again their date was quite the adventure but oh boy did the sparks fly. There were so many mishaps that occurred on their date that you found yourself hoping things get worked out quick. It was a fun quick read. 4

Stars: 4.5

Road Trip Collection- A Timeless Romance Anthology


Synopsis:

From the publisher of the USA TODAY bestselling Timeless Romance Anthology series comes Road Trip Collection... Six contemporary romance novellas from bestselling authors:
What Falling Feels Like by Jolene Betty Perry
Antiques Road Trip by Sarah M. Eden
Wouldn't It Be Nice by Ranee S. Clark
Head Over Heels by Annette Lyon
Two Dozen Roses by Heather B. Moore
Try, Try Again by Aubrey Mace

Review:

I love when Timeless Romance Anthologies do collections of contemporary romance stories. I love road trips and these stories made me want to go on an adventure. These are all very unique but all sweet stories with happily ever after.

What Falling Feels Like was a sweet story about Kendall and Tyler (who is her best friends brother) travel to see Ivy... Tyler's sister and Kendall's best friend. She and Tyler had always been friends but she didn't know what his true feelings were. It was a story of finding yourself so you can give yourself to someone else. It is a quick read that kept me reading page by page to the end because I wanted to see what was going to happen. Loved it! It was very cute.

Antiques Road Trip was a fun and very unique story about a reality tv show. Kelsey loves the 19th Century so it's been a longtime dream to be on this tv show and it finally happened. She got very sick while doing it and her fiance' (as part of the show) took good care of her and was such a gentleman. This was very well written and such a cute idea for a story.

Wouldn't It Be Nice was about Jac who goes on a road trip with some friends and it led to finding love when she had just ended her relationship. She recently broke up with her boyfriend Colin realizing his job would always be the most important. Jac's long time friend Hudson joined the trip and the chemistry was sizzling between the two of them but Jac wanted to make sure to make the right decision for herself. The writing was great and it reminds you that those in your life and relationships are most important. It was very sweet!

Head Over Heels was so much fun! Tristan runs her own singles blog and was at an event in Salt Lake when she meets someone during a speed dating activity and feels a connection but then doesn't have a chance to get to know him more. She is asked to go to Vegas for a new singles event when her friend sets up a ride for her to Vegas when he shows up there he is. Ahh I loved this so much. They were cute and funny together and were pranking her friend when the sparks really started. Loved the story idea and the writing kept you turning the pages. So Cute!

Two Dozen Roses was an adventurous book that made me want to take a road trip up the Pacific Coast Highway. I love that Dayna was going on a road trip with her Mom and along the way they met two brothers that were doing the same trip. Dayna catches the eye of both brothers but of course she only has eyes for one of them and their connection develops at each stop. It was a fun flirty book that you find yourself hoping they can make it work when they get home. It was very well written and is another great novella by Heather.

Try, Try Again is a rom-com that I found myself smiling while I read it. Sarah drags her pregnant best friend on a road trip to Boise, Idaho for a friends, grandpa's funeral. She wanted to see if there was anything there with Justin and the flames are rekindled. I loved her friend, the way it was written and the second chance at love. It was cute, clean story.

Stars: 4.5

Firsts and Lasts by Annette Lyon

Synopsis:

Dani has failed in her dreams to catch a break as a dancer in New York, but before she heads home to the Midwest, she decides to visit the places still on her to-see list. Then she meets Mark, another transplant to the Big Apple with big dreams of his own. Except Mark hasn't given up on his. As they spend the day together, Dani realizes that even though she hasn't hit the big time, she may be able to live her dreams after all. Only one problem: she's broke and has a one-way ticket home.

Review:

This is a very cute quick read about two artists struggling to make ends meet in New York. Dani has decided to head back home in 10 days but before doing so she plans to do the touristy things she hasn't had a chance to do. She has a chance encounter with Mark who turns her last 10 days in to her best 10 days of the last 6 months. Their friendship develops and soon feelings for more develop on both sides but she's leaving so soon. I loved this book about not giving up on dreams and building connections with those in your life. I have always wanted to visit New York and the details of the sites in this book has moved it up my travel list. This was a very well written short novella.

Stars: 4.5
